    About the CLK GTR SS:http://www.*************/cars/2225.html

    "The second car, chassis #017, was modeled after the upgrade on #003. It came straight from HWA with the 7.3 engine and was the only car to officially receive the Super Sports designation. Painted in the unique red over tan combination, Mr.Ilyas Galadari of UAE-Dubai was the first owner. The car was then sold to an owner in Switzerland who took it back to HWA for a coat of silver paint and red interior. Next, the car was shipped to the USA as brokered by thecarexperience.com. They successfully imported the car, and it now resides in the US."
